Abstract
The utility model discloses a lake surface cleaning ship. The lake surface cleaning ship comprises a double-body ship, a ship power mechanism and a garbage collecting mechanism. The double-body ship is composed of two cabins. The ship power mechanism is arranged at the tail end of the cabins, and comprises a propeller, a coupler, a lead screw, a motor I, a support, a solar cell panel, a support and a storage battery. The garbage collecting mechanism is arranged between the two cabins, and comprises a supporting base I, a rotating shaft, a rotating brush, a motor II, a supporting base II, a transmission shaft, a swing rod, a swing brush, a motor III and a dustbin. The solar cell penal collecting solar energy and converting the solar energy to electric energy is adopted as a generating device of a power supply of a motor respectively driving the ship power mechanism and the garbage collecting mechanism, and therefore the lake surface cleaning ship is energy-saving and environment-friendly. Motor control signals are transmitted in a remote control mode so as to ensure that an operator on the shore controls the ship power mechanism and the garbage collecting mechanism through a remote control emitter, and therefore the lake surface cleaning ship is simple and convenient to operate.

Background technology
At present, the mode that lake surface is handled floating debris has two kinds usually, a kind of mode is to adopt on the bank manually that cleaning tools such as the rope made of hemp, rake, spade are directly salvaged, another kind of mode is artificially to salvage at lake surface by ship, and dual mode all exists to be salvaged that efficient is low, waste of manpower, be difficult to comprehensively and thoroughly remove the problem of lake surface floating debris; Artificial by ship simultaneously salvaging also existence wastes energy, and boats and ships use conventional energy resources easily to cause the lake surface pollution problems.

When using this lake surface clean ship, solar panel is constantly collected solar power and is converted to electrical power storage in storage battery, and storage battery is given motor I, motor II and the power supply of motor III respectively; The motor I drives leading screw by drive belt and rotates; The leading screw rotation is converted to screw propeller by coupler and swings, thereby drives foot; Described motor II is by the rotation of drive belt driven rotary axle, thereby three rotating brush rotations of well-distributed on the driven rotary axle are carried out the lake surface floating debris and collected; The motor III drives transmission shaft by drive belt and rotates, and the transmission shaft two ends drive the swing of pendulum brush by fork, thereby sends in the rubbish container then the lake surface floating debris brush of collecting on the rotating brush down; Give electric machine controller after utilizing remote control transmitter transmission motor control signal via receiver of remote-control sytem simultaneously, electric machine controller is controlled motor I, motor II and motor III rotational action respectively, can realize artificially controlling on the bank.
